summaryrefslogtreecommitdiff
path: root/mysql-test/suite/versioning
diff options
context:
space:
mode:
authorSergei Golubchik <serg@mariadb.org>2019-03-27 16:35:19 +0100
committerSergei Golubchik <serg@mariadb.org>2019-03-29 12:51:19 +0100
commita82cfe109cbc033253ddaba82f9c2de663601002 (patch)
tree6b976f2237552cd948d6d8ed271075e770864365 /mysql-test/suite/versioning
parent39d7e5969ba06f78d44e5cbd1ea72f882f3a5e66 (diff)
downloadmariadb-git-a82cfe109cbc033253ddaba82f9c2de663601002.tar.gz
cleanup: move rbr-only test to rpl_row.test
Diffstat (limited to 'mysql-test/suite/versioning')
-rw-r--r--mysql-test/suite/versioning/r/rpl.result13
-rw-r--r--mysql-test/suite/versioning/r/rpl_row.result14
-rw-r--r--mysql-test/suite/versioning/t/rpl.test17
-rw-r--r--mysql-test/suite/versioning/t/rpl_row.test18
4 files changed, 32 insertions, 30 deletions
diff --git a/mysql-test/suite/versioning/r/rpl.result b/mysql-test/suite/versioning/r/rpl.result
index 8db963f9ea4..fd62a65f473 100644
--- a/mysql-test/suite/versioning/r/rpl.result
+++ b/mysql-test/suite/versioning/r/rpl.result
@@ -164,17 +164,4 @@ update t1 set i = 0;
connection slave;
connection master;
drop table t1;
-# MDEV-16252: MINIMAL binlog_row_image does not work for versioned tables
-set @old_row_image= @@binlog_row_image;
-set binlog_row_image= minimal;
-create or replace table t1 (pk int, i int, primary key(pk))
-with system versioning;
-insert into t1 values (1,10),(2,20);
-update t1 set i = 0;
-connection slave;
-connection master;
-drop table t1;
-set binlog_row_image= @old_row_image;
-drop database test;
-create database test;
include/rpl_end.inc
diff --git a/mysql-test/suite/versioning/r/rpl_row.result b/mysql-test/suite/versioning/r/rpl_row.result
new file mode 100644
index 00000000000..03ac8dc9eb8
--- /dev/null
+++ b/mysql-test/suite/versioning/r/rpl_row.result
@@ -0,0 +1,14 @@
+include/master-slave.inc
+[connection master]
+# MDEV-16252: MINIMAL binlog_row_image does not work for versioned tables
+set @old_row_image= @@binlog_row_image;
+set binlog_row_image= minimal;
+create or replace table t1 (pk int, i int, primary key(pk))
+with system versioning;
+insert into t1 values (1,10),(2,20);
+update t1 set i = 0;
+connection slave;
+connection master;
+drop table t1;
+set binlog_row_image= @old_row_image;
+include/rpl_end.inc
diff --git a/mysql-test/suite/versioning/t/rpl.test b/mysql-test/suite/versioning/t/rpl.test
index 2549684da51..e59d41c38a3 100644
--- a/mysql-test/suite/versioning/t/rpl.test
+++ b/mysql-test/suite/versioning/t/rpl.test
@@ -133,21 +133,4 @@ sync_slave_with_master;
connection master;
drop table t1;
---echo # MDEV-16252: MINIMAL binlog_row_image does not work for versioned tables
-set @old_row_image= @@binlog_row_image;
-set binlog_row_image= minimal;
-
-create or replace table t1 (pk int, i int, primary key(pk))
-with system versioning;
-insert into t1 values (1,10),(2,20);
-update t1 set i = 0;
-
---sync_slave_with_master
---connection master
-drop table t1;
-set binlog_row_image= @old_row_image;
-
-drop database test;
-create database test;
-
--source include/rpl_end.inc
diff --git a/mysql-test/suite/versioning/t/rpl_row.test b/mysql-test/suite/versioning/t/rpl_row.test
new file mode 100644
index 00000000000..17ce2dfdcf8
--- /dev/null
+++ b/mysql-test/suite/versioning/t/rpl_row.test
@@ -0,0 +1,18 @@
+--source include/have_binlog_format_row.inc
+--source include/master-slave.inc
+
+--echo # MDEV-16252: MINIMAL binlog_row_image does not work for versioned tables
+set @old_row_image= @@binlog_row_image;
+set binlog_row_image= minimal;
+
+create or replace table t1 (pk int, i int, primary key(pk))
+with system versioning;
+insert into t1 values (1,10),(2,20);
+update t1 set i = 0;
+
+--sync_slave_with_master
+--connection master
+drop table t1;
+set binlog_row_image= @old_row_image;
+
+--source include/rpl_end.inc